Avoid using cooking wine. An inexpensive but good-quality drinking wine works best. Substitute with grape juice for a non-alcoholic version. Garlic: Fresh cloves are the best choice. Garlic powder or jarred minced garlic can be used in a pinch. Shallots: Fresh shallots bring the best flavor. Substitute with red or yellow onions if necessary.

The tenderloin is paired with a gorgeous French-style red wine reduction sauce, made by simmering a mixture of butter, shallots, red wine, and beef broth until the flavors deepen and intensify. Once reduced, a beurre manié (or flour and butter paste) is whisked in to thicken the sauce and give it a glossy sheen—yes, it's fancy!

Warm a skillet on medium-high heat and melt the butter. When butter is fully melted and starting to bubble, add the finely chopped shallots and sauté for 2-3 minutes. Add a pinch or two of salt to bring out the flavor of the shallots. Optional herbs can be added to the pan while sautéing shallots to infuse more flavor.
